On the other hand, the better evidentiary threshold of very clear and convincing proof may mean that actually weak or dubious instances is not going to prosper, reinforcing that annulment just isn't such as no-fault divorce. Family members looking for A fast exit from relationship purely for advantage will discover that the courts even now demand from customers concrete evidence of an enduring inability to comply with marital obligations. The Catholic Church, which continues to be influential while in the Philippines, has cautiously welcomed the Courtroom’s clarification that Short article 36 isn't meant to cover merely “emotionally distant or unfaithful” spouses Unless of course a genuine psychological issue is present. Church regulation (Canon Legislation) tribunals have lengthy experienced an idea of nullity for psychological incapacity, and Short article 36 was originally inspired by this notion. The civil Supreme Court’s nuanced strategy may provide civil annulments closer for the spirit of Church annulments, focusing on the incapacity to undertake marital responsibilities from the beginning.
